Pacers final score: Pacers avoid trap against Hawks, win 97-89

The Indiana Pacers refused to make things easy in their home win against the Atlanta Hawks, trailing by 14 points a minute out of the break before finally deciding enough was enough. To that point, the Pacers were barely involved, seeing their lone bright spot, a 14-1 run in the second quarter, obliterated to close the half, ending up on the wrong side of a 17-0 run that put them behind 61-47.

Indiana was out of sorts in part due to an injury exit for Victor Oladipo. Oladipo had been questionable for the game with knee soreness and came up grimacing after falling into a cameraman on a drive.
